I will say this about ACR

The SNG games are almost non existent. A few might run here and there but you will not be grinding them that's for sure. The MTTs are not that great either in my opinion. Some of the GTDs have decent overlays but they don't have the traffic to support large amounts of them.

The cash games are where most of the 3-4k people (I have seen close to 4.5k at peak a night ago, it seems to be growing) are at. Seems to run more 6max then fullring at the micro-low limits. 25NL+ seems to have decent traffic.

The tables that run both BBJ and Beast rake the tears from your eyes at the lower limits, so it's usually best to look for the normal tables. Go to raketherake and get RB. I can usually avoid them.

They have p2p transfers and western union. I will pay a little more in silly rake race programs if I am compensated with more simple ways to move money. Your mileage may very.

As of right now 3:15 CST there are 3620 logged in
